Kemp Town is one of Brighton’s most vibrant and characterful areas, known for its Regency architecture, independent shops and strong sense of community. From the apartment, you are just moments from the seafront and promenade, perfect for morning walks, sea swims or simply sitting by the water.
St James’s Street and the surrounding streets offer an excellent selection of independent cafés, bakeries, restaurants and pubs, giving the area a real neighbourhood feel. Brighton city centre, the Lanes and the Royal Pavilion are all within walking distance along the seafront.
The area also benefits from Brighton Marina nearby, offering supermarkets, cinema, gym and waterfront restaurants.
Transport links
The property is well positioned for access across the city. Regular bus services run along the seafront and St James’s Street, connecting to Brighton Station and beyond. Brighton Station provides direct rail services to London and Gatwick Airport, making the property suitable for commuters or as a second home by the sea.
